Output f6991ae23d58f4300ce961101801dffdd22be60fde22981791e98620885c896f:22

value
762388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b40843c9e6d6c68dbdcb16898fa456df8ed994 OP_EQUAL
address
3NdaLLQKCNpUEXsPkTJoYoU4ijDG2GjGwk
transaction
f6991ae23d58f4300ce961101801dffdd22be60fde22981791e98620885c896f